Description
An original copy of The Romance of Submarine Engineering by Thomas Corbin. An antiquarian diving book published in 1913 in Philadelphia. A very collectible book that features photos of Siebe Gorman equipment, but more unusual, one of two named divers in what looks like brand new Heinke Pearler helmets. The inside back cover has two Heinke items pasted to it. Chapters titled The Diver and his Dress, The Evolution of the Divers Dress, Salvage, The Diver at Work, plus numerous Submarine chapters. Gold embossed cover and spine, showing a Heinke Pearler helmet on the cover, and the Siebe Gorman shallow-water/submarine escape helmet on the spine. 316 pages with b&w photos and diagrams. The book content is shown in the photos and the book content is in good condition. After surviving over a hundred years there is the expected wear, some loss at the top and bottom of the spine, and the spine cover is becoming detached from the front and back cover and can be seen in the photos but could be repaired. Not an ex-library book and no inscriptions or previous owners details. Comes with a protective book cover. An uncommon book dealing with diving and submarine advances of the period.
